On 20th December 2025 spotters and journalists at Tashkent🇺🇿 airport welcomed the first Airbus A321XLR in Central Asia and CIS countries.
The Uzbekistan's first private airline Qanot Sharq became the first operator of this type in former Soviet countries. The aircraft with tail number UK32112 is leased from Air Lease🇺🇸 and was delivered strait from Airbus factory in Hamburg.
Due to the weather conditions (showering snow and negative temperature) it wasn't possible to organize traditional water salute, however the aircraft was still solemnly welcomed, presented to journalists. The event and speeches by airline's CEO Moisey Vasilyevich Pak, representatives of Airbus and administration of Uzbekistan Civil Aviation Agency with participation of diplomatic corps of embassies of Germany and France in Uzbekistan ended with a solemn buffet and gift presentation.
Qanot Sharq and Air Lease Corporation signed an agreement on 18th February 2025, which stated that Qanot Sharq will receive three new A321XLR and two A321neo for operational leasing from order portfolio of Air Lease form Airbus corporation until the end of 2027.
This aircraft will mostly be used on regular flights to London and flights to popular destinations in Asia. The aircraft has a 16C@45" + 174Y@31" seat configuration and adjustable seats with a pitch of 18" and leather headrests. Seats are equipped with personal charging ports and entertainment system with access through passenger's personal electronic device which allows to comfortably operate flights within longer range.

Main specifications of the aircraft type:
Length: 44.51m
Wingspan: 35.80m
Height: 11.76m
Fuselage diameter: 3.95m
Width of passenger cabin: 3.70m
Length of passenger cabin: 34.44m
Baggage capacity: 9-10 pallets or LD3-45W containers
Range with commercial load: 8700km
Flight time: up to 11 hours
Maximum take off weight: 101.5t
Cruise speed: 0.82М
Main difference between XLR and А321Neo is presence of additional 12900l fuel tank which is located behind the main gear compartment (in sections 15-17), revised automatic trimming system and significantly improved navigation system control block in the cockpit.

Ilyushin Il-76TD EX-76028 (ex UK76427) after completing of all necessary restoration works left runway 08 of the Tashkent Eastern (Vostochny) TVT/UZTP airport and waived by the wing approached directly to it's new owner the New Way Cargo company to Bishkek (Kyrgyzstan). This aircraft was stored since 2016 and was the latest Il-76 in a flying condition grounded on the former TAPOiCh home airfield and owned by the corporation.
So, the four D-30KP engines with their smoky trails put the final fat point of the TAPOiCh corporation's history and the Tashkent-Eastern(Vostochnyj) airport passed to it's new life as business- and government- only aerodrome.

On November 6, 2025, an Ilyushin Il-76TD bearing the registration XT-ABL (Burkina Faso) took off from Tashkent Eastern (Vostochny) Airport, heading to Fujairah, UAE. According to preliminary information, the aircraft has been acquired by Batot Air.
Expand
As reported by russianplanes.net, this Il-76TD had been stored since November 2006. It's story began in January 1992, when it performed its first flight as СССР-76831, built and operated by TAPOiCh (Tashkent Aviation Production Association named after V. P. Chkalov). In 1993, it was leased to Uzbekistan Airways and re-registered as UK76831, under which it flew for another 13 years.
Now, after nearly two decades of silence, this legendary heavy transport aircraft has come back to life. It is one of the last two remaining Il-76s on the grounds of the former Tashkent Aviation Production Association (TAPOiCh) — once a proud symbol of Soviet and Uzbek aviation engineering.

On 17th October 2025 9th official spotting tour occurred at Tashkent international airport.
Traditionally, over 50 photographers from Uzbekistan🇺🇿, Russia🇷🇺, Kazakhstan🇰🇿 and Belarus🇧🇾 participated. According to established custom attendants' age wasn't limited.
As a part of the tour participants had a unique opportunity to watch and film take-offs and landings while standing on airport's apron. Spotters captured both passenger and cargo flights of such airlines as Loong Air, Air Asia, Fly Dubai, S7, China Eastern, Air China, My Freighter, Air Astana, Aeroflot, Somon Air, Tez Jet, aircraft of Ministry of Defense of Uzbekisan.
We were especially pleased by crews of Uzbekistan Helicopters who were performing training flights on that day and were happy to demonstrate the beauty of their Airbus Helicopters H125 and H130.

On 15th October 2025 at 17:40 airplane of AirAsia's first flight on Kuala Lumpur - Tashkent route landed in Tashkent international airport. Aircraft with 218 passengers onboard was traditionally welcomed with a water salute and crew with flowers.
Check-in for passengers on the first flight also took place in festive atmosphere. Representatives of AirAsia and Uzbekistan Airports participated in the ceremony of cutting the red rope and the celebratory torte. Performance of national choreography collective was prepared for passengers gave the event special flavor and festive mood.
Flights on Kuala Lumpur - Tashkent - Kuala Lumpur route will be performed three times a week on Mondays, Wednesdays and Fridays on wide-body Airbus A330 aircrfats.

On 23 May at 21:56 Boeing B777-300 HL8707🇰🇷 landed at Tashkent international airport after operation fist regular flight TW-431 of T'way Air from Seoul (ICN).
Aircraft was traditionally welcomed with a water salute, crew with flowers and a solemn ceremony was held inside airport's terminal. On board the first flight there were 216 passengers including a well-known Korean musical group 🎸BLACKSWAN.
🔸 T'way Air is a South Korean low-cost airline founded in 2010 with headquarters in Seoul .
🗒 Flight schedule: TW-431/TW-432:
ICN 18.00 -> TAS 21.30
TAS 23.00 -> ICN 09.25+1 (local time)
Aircraft types: B777 on Wednesdays and Sundays, A333 on Mondays and Fridays.

On 25th April 2025 another official spring spotting tour took place at Tashkent international airport.
This spring over 50 people from Uzbekistan🇺🇿, Russia🇷🇺, Kazakhstan🇰🇿, Belarus🇧🇾, Türkiye🇹🇷 and Republic of Korea🇰🇷 participated. According to an established tradition airport didn't put any limitations on participants' minimum age.
Over the course of the day spotters had ability to film aircrafts of both Uzbek airlines (Uzbekistan Airways, Silk Avia, FlyKhiva, Centrum/My Freighter, Qanot Sharq, UAT) and foreign visitors.
Considering huge interest in retired machines airport prepared .a surprise in the form of opportunity to photograph stored aircrafts, such as Il-114, Il-76, Tu-154 and Mi-8 previously on behalf of Uzbekistan's flag carrier and air force.
